TY - JOUR T1 - The Design and Trial of High School Math Activities Based on DNR Framework TT - فعالیتهای درسی ریاضی مبتنی بر چارچوب برنامه‌ریزی درسی ریاضی DNR (دوگانی- نیازهای فکورانه - استدلالهای پی در پی)  JF - qjoe JO - qjoe VL - 34 IS - 3 UR - http://qjoe.ir/article-1-1225-en.html Y1 - 2018 SP - 9 EP - 32 KW - cognitive perspective KW - DNR framework KW - math learning activity KW - math curriculum KW - Cartesian coordinate system KW - high school N2 - To help with the improvement of the high school math curriculum, a theoretical framework named DNR (Duality-Necessity-Repeated Reasoning) was employed in order to identify activities and appropriate methods for teaching certain concepts in high school math. These activities and methods were initially used experimentally by the first author in real high school math classes, and then during the final stage of the experiment, the concepts of Cartesian coordinate system and the display of lines within this system were presented to three classes of 9th graders while their regular teacher was observing and giving critical feedback. The collected data revealed that the designed activities and methods facilitated learning the presented math concepts to a greater depth and fill many gaps impeding learning within the current curriculum.
